MESC TOOL NEWS:
MESCT-NC79WA-000901D
NC79WA V.4.00 Release 1 Upgraded Version Announcement
|
This is to announce that C compiler NC308WA for the 7900 series MCUs (with an assembler and integrated development environment)
has been upgraded from its V.3.20 Release 2 to V.4.00 Release 1.
- Descriptions of Upgrade
- 1.1 New Features
- (1) Enhanced optimization such as "for" loop unrolling
- (2) Warning of omission of including standard library header files
- (3) High-speed compilation
- (4)Improved function of outputting information on the stack and mapping: Visualized outputs of information and easy operation using
GUI, such as the STK and map viewers, improve workability in development.
- (5) Improved DPnDATA declaration utility"dputl"(the former "dputl")
- 1.2 Problems Fixed
- (1) The unary "~" operator may not be processed in as79.
- For details refer to "NC79WA, AS79 Precautions" issued on June 16, 2000.
- (2) Windows' error message may appear when an optimize option used.
- For details refer to "PC-Version NC308WA, NC30WA, NC79WA, NC77WA Precautions" issued on May 1, 2000.
- (3) User and group IDs become indefinite at the installation of the product.
- For details refer to "EWS-Version C Compilers Assemblers, and Real-Time OSes Precautions " issued on April 1, 2000.
- (4) Error messages may not appear at linking even if labels are double-defined.
- For details refer to "AS308, AS30, and AS79 Precautions" issued on March 1, 2000.
- (5) The relocatable file or command option just before EOF cannot be executed unless a carriage return is entered prior to EOF.
- For details refer to "AS79 Precaution" issued on December 16, 1999.
- 1.3 Notes
- The following problems described in items of news issued on and after July 1, 2000, concern this English version of NC79WA:
- (1) Assigning the address of a function to a pointer to another function of another type results in system errors.
- For details refer to"NC308WA, NC30WA, NC79WA, NC77WA Precautions" issued on July 16, 2000.
- (2) Folding floating-point constants may cause incorrect subtract operations.
- For details refer to "NC308WA, NC30WA, NC79WA, NC77WA Precautions" issued on July 16, 2000.
- (3) Converting the type of floating-point constants to the unsigned long one may cause their values to become incorrect.
- For details refer to "NC308WA, NC30WA, NC79WA, and NC77WA Precautions" issued on August 1, 2000.
